The British Journal of Psychiatry 153: 105-107 (1988)
© 1988 The Royal College of Psychiatrists
LB Greenberg, R Mofson and M Fink
Department of Psychiatry and Behavioral Science, SUNY, Stony Brook 11794.
The prospective, successful, use of ECT in a patient with a frontal meningioma is described. The authors review the literature on ECT in patients with brain tumours, and suggest factors predictive of a favourable outcome.
